Being a widely acclaimed religion, Islam and its political history and futuristic approach has always been topic of a great debate among the scholars.This study will have a practical utility for the scholars around the world as it will enhance understanding about the basis on which the Muslims are being grouped.The study will further attempt to make it clear how far Daniel Pipes has been unbiased in his critique on Islam.Item Dr. Ali shariati on islamic thought (An analytical Study)(UMT Lahore, 2012) Neelam BanoDr. Ali Sharīatī emerged on the intellectual horizons of Iran in 1970’s, and his ideas proved forerunner for the Islamic revolution. He believed that modernization would be reliable with traditional Islamic belief that’s why he was most popular among young revolutionaries of Iran. Sharīatī’s fame in Iran is that of a promoter and advocate of Revolution, a political activist, and a Sociologist. With his powerful pen and eloquent mode of expression he was able to provide the most complex scientific and sociological issues. His ideas have still strong resonance within Iranian society. This paper seeks to explore his biography and also underlines the major works through which he tried to regenerate the Muslim society. The paper probes into analysis of the intellectual contribution of Ali Sharīatī to Muslim thought by exploring his Islamic, sociological and political ideas and evaluation of his thought by other contemporary scholars.Item English literature on seerah studies in pakistan (21st century)(UMT Lahore, 2012) Syed Tauqeer MahmoodSeerah books of 21st century in English by Pakistani writers have been reviewed and compiled.
